| Summary: | Title screen The parton-level top quark (t) forward-backward asymmetry and the anomalous chromoelectric (d^t) and chromomagnetic (μ^t)moments have been measured using LHC pp collisions at a center-of-mass energy of 13 TeV, collected in the CMS detector in a data sample cor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 35.9 fb−1. The linearized variable A(1)FB is used to approximate the asymmetry. Candidate tt¯ events decaying to a muon or electron and jets in final states with low and high Lorentz boosts are selected and reconstructed using a fit of the kinematic distributions of the decay products to those expected for tt¯final states. |
